About The Position

The School of Engineering, Department of Mechanical Engineering is seeking a dependable, personable individual to join our award-winning team as an academics coordinator. This individual will plan and coordinate day-to-day fiscal, administrative, and operational activities of an academic unit. Working with the accountant, senior academic advisor, and department chair, this person will report to the department administrator. We are looking for an individual with a history of successful customer service-related administrative employment, proven ability to project manage assigned tasks, worked with a variety of UNM fiscal tasks, and a willingness to work with others to make changes in scheduling and operational functions. The successful candidate will complete a variety of administrative support duties for the department. This requires a range of skills and a knowledge of UNM policies and procedures. Specifically, this individual will: Serves as a principal liaison between students and/or faculty, staff, other departments, and/or external constituencies on day-to-day programmatic, operational, and administrative issues. Resolves administrative problems, as appropriate, and/or refers problems to key faculty or staff for resolution. Monitors, reconciles, and assists with fiscal administration for the unit, including but not limited to budgets, funding, grants, contracts, payroll, employment, travel, and purchasing; may assist with fiscal planning, including participating in seeking alternate sources of funding. Have previous experience in course scheduling, Kuali, and an understanding of UNM catalog. Will work with advising, department chair, and department administrator on course scheduling. Coordinates and/or facilitates seminars, meetings, special projects, faculty/staff searches, and evaluates the success of these events. Serves as UKG time keeper with knowledge of UNM policies related to time entry and payroll. May coordinate the activities of support staff, consultants, faculty, and/or volunteers engaged in implementation and administration of unit objectives. May serve as Campus Security Authority as outlined by the Clery Act. Ability to maintain confidential information (FERPA, HR). Ability to multi-task, i.e. assist faculty, staff and students in various tasks or answer inquiries, sometimes simultaneously
